The Mobile Pixels 27" WQHD Mini-LED Gaming Monitor and Samsung Odyssey 3D G90XF represent opposite ends of the innovation spectrum. Mobile Pixels focuses on perfecting established technology—they've taken Mini-LED backlighting (a relatively new advancement where thousands of tiny LEDs behind the screen provide precise brightness control) and implemented it flawlessly in a gaming context. This approach prioritizes proven performance gains that benefit every game and application.
Samsung, meanwhile, has bet big on glasses-free 3D technology. Using eye-tracking cameras and specialized software, the Odyssey 3D G90XF creates a genuine three-dimensional viewing experience without requiring special glasses. This represents a massive technological leap, though it comes with significant trade-offs in compatibility and content availability.
The resolution difference is equally significant: the Mobile Pixels monitor uses 2560 x 1440 resolution (often called WQHD or 1440p), while the Samsung display features full 4K at 3840 x 2160 pixels. Higher resolution means sharper images and more screen real estate, but it also demands more from your graphics card and can impact performance.
Refresh rate measures how many times per second your monitor can display a new image, expressed in Hertz (Hz). The Mobile Pixels monitor supports up to 180Hz, while the Samsung Odyssey 3D maxes out at 165Hz. In practical terms, this 15Hz difference is minimal—both far exceed what most gamers can effectively utilize.
More importantly, both monitors achieve the gold standard 1ms response time, which measures how quickly pixels can change from one color to another. This virtually eliminates motion blur and ghosting, ensuring crisp visuals during fast-paced action sequences. From my experience testing various gaming monitors, anything under 5ms feels responsive, so both monitors excel here.
The real performance differentiator lies in how consistently these monitors maintain their performance. The Mobile Pixels display benefits from its Mini-LED backlight technology, which provides more precise control over brightness zones. This translates to better performance in mixed lighting conditions—dark scenes won't lose detail when bright elements appear on screen.
Both monitors support adaptive sync technologies that eliminate screen tearing (when the monitor displays parts of multiple frames simultaneously, creating a "torn" appearance). The Mobile Pixels monitor supports AMD FreeSync Premium, while the Samsung display supports both FreeSync Premium and NVIDIA G-SYNC compatibility.
These technologies synchronize your graphics card's output with the monitor's refresh rate, creating smoother gameplay even when frame rates fluctuate. In my testing, the difference between various sync implementations is minimal—what matters more is having some form of adaptive sync, which both monitors provide.
This is where the Mobile Pixels monitor truly shines, literally. With 1000 nits peak brightness and HDR1000 certification, it can display incredibly bright highlights while maintaining deep, dark shadows. HDR (High Dynamic Range) technology expands the range between the darkest blacks and brightest whites, creating more lifelike images.
The Mini-LED backlighting technology deserves special attention here. Traditional LED monitors use edge lighting or a full backlight array, but Mini-LED uses thousands of tiny LEDs for incredibly precise brightness control. This enables the Mobile Pixels display to achieve a dynamic contrast ratio of 1,000,000:1—meaning the brightest whites are one million times brighter than the darkest blacks.
In contrast, the Samsung Odyssey 3D uses a standard IPS (In-Plane Switching) panel with typical brightness around 350 nits and a static contrast ratio of 1000:1. While this provides good color accuracy and wide viewing angles, it can't match the dramatic visual impact of Mini-LED technology, especially in dark room viewing or HDR content.
Color performance varies significantly between these monitors. The Mobile Pixels display covers 94% of the DCI-P3 color space (a wide color standard used in cinema), 99% sRGB (the standard web color space), and 95% Adobe RGB (important for photo editing). This comprehensive color coverage makes it excellent for both gaming and creative work.
The Samsung monitor achieves 99% sRGB coverage with good factory calibration, but the 3D layer slightly reduces perceived sharpness compared to traditional displays. This trade-off is inherent to the 3D technology—the lenticular lens array and tracking systems that enable glasses-free 3D inevitably affect image clarity.
For gamers who also do photo editing, video production, or graphic design, the Mobile Pixels monitor's superior color accuracy provides significant value. The difference is noticeable when working with color-critical content, though casual users might not notice the distinction during typical gaming sessions.
The Samsung Odyssey 3D G90XF's glasses-free 3D technology represents genuinely impressive engineering. Using dual eye-tracking cameras, the monitor continuously monitors your head position and adjusts the 3D effect accordingly. The result is surprisingly convincing depth that makes games feel more immersive when it works well.
However, the technology faces significant limitations. The 3D effect only works with PC gaming—consoles like PlayStation 5 or Xbox Series X cannot utilize the 3D features. More critically, the library of natively supported 3D games remains quite small at launch. Samsung's Reality Hub software can convert some 2D content to 3D using AI, but the results are inconsistent and often less impressive than native 3D content.
I've found that when the 3D works well, particularly with games designed specifically for the technology, the experience feels genuinely revolutionary. However, the limited content library means most of your gaming time will be spent in traditional 2D mode, where the Samsung monitor performs adequately but doesn't excel compared to the Mobile Pixels display.

The Mobile Pixels monitor's Mini-LED system uses hundreds of dimming zones to control brightness with incredible precision. When a scene shows a bright explosion against a dark sky, traditional monitors might wash out the dark areas to accommodate the bright elements. Mini-LED technology can keep the sky dark while making the explosion brilliantly bright, creating a more realistic and engaging visual experience.
This technology also enables the monitor's impressive HDR performance. HDR content is mastered with specific brightness levels in mind, and the Mobile Pixels display can actually reproduce those brightness levels accurately, while most monitors compress the brightness range and lose the intended visual impact.
The Samsung Odyssey 3D's eye-tracking system operates at high frequency to maintain the 3D effect as you move. The monitor splits the 4K image into two 1920x2160 images—one for each eye—and uses the lenticular lens array to direct the appropriate image to each eye based on your head position.
This processing demands significant computational resources. Running 3D content at full 4K resolution requires a high-end graphics card (RTX 3080 or better is recommended) because the system is essentially rendering two separate viewpoints simultaneously.
